21 minutes ago, Waju said:
I had this trouble some time ago and this is how I resolved it - log on to pocruises.com/myaccount - you will find the space to enter your account number (URN) under 'my details' towards the bottom of the page. Your account number (URN) is your Peninsular Club number - mine starts POFA****D but when entering it I have to omit the PO and just enter FA then the 5 numbers and D.
All works perfectly now!
Hope that helps.
Thanks for the info, but as this is my first cruise with P&O, I am not yet a member of the Peninsular club. Apparently you have to spend 15 nights on board before you become a member, you can't join prior to your first cruise like other cruise lines.
